Tetra 2 is a military microsatellite created for various prototype missions in and around geosynchronous earth orbit.
The satellites will support experimentation and Tactics, Techniques and Procedure (TTP) development at Geostationary Earth Orbit (GEO). TETRA-2 is based on Millennium Space Systems' Altair-class small satellite product line. This satellite is to demonstrate “interesting maneuverability options”.
